Nyandezulu Community Project - Concluded
On the appeal of Mayor Sithembiso Cele of Ugu Municipality, a small group of business people operating out of KwaZulu-Natal’s South Coast Region, in 2009 successfully concluded a community based construction project, in the Gamalakhe township west of Port Shepstone. That particular initiative was aimed at providing a home for two young boys who had lost their parents 3 years prior.
On 11 November 2009 at the handover ceremony, it was unanimously agreed that the occasion marked a beginning rather than an end. While presenting the Shozi family with the key to their new home, an emotionally charged Cele first made mention of what would become the group’s next community initiative, again in conjunction with Master Builders Kwazulu-Natal.
Eight months later on Thursday 22 July 2010 another handover ceremony took place, this time at the Nyandezulu site to celebrate the conclusion of the group’s second community non profit venture. It was a joyous occasion which brought with it a unique sense of contentment that comes with making a tangible difference in the lives of those less fortunate.
The project intended to provide a home for the Albertinia Gigaba, was again spearheaded by Ray Basson representing Master Builders KwaZulu-Natal, along with George Enslin of Wakefields. Albertinia is an elderly lady who had as a teacher served her community admirably. In her twilight years she found herself without a home and as the project’s beneficiary, is now able to enjoy a dignified retirement.

Mayor Cele praised the Association, its members, and all who contributed for their willingness and generosity. When addressing the audience he graciously thanked all who participated and commended them for appreciating that government can’t do it alone. “Together we can do more,” Cele remarked.
